CVE-2024-0235
The EventON WordPress plugin prior to 4.5.5, EventON WordPress plugin prior to 2.2.7 do not have authorisation in an AJAX action, allowing unauthenticated users to retrieve email addresses of any users on the blog
Myeventon Eventon
5.3
CVSSv3
CVE-2024-0236
The EventON WordPress plugin prior to 4.5.5, EventON WordPress plugin prior to 2.2.7 do not have authorisation in an AJAX action, allowing unauthenticated users to retrieve the settings of arbitrary virtual events, including any meeting password set (for example for Zoom)
